検索

ホームページ  >  に質問  >  本文

SQL 仮想テーブル/一時テーブルのアプローチのデモ: 連想配列からのデータの抽出

<p>データベースに仮想テーブルを作成せずに仮想/一時テーブルを表示するには、単純な SQL クエリが必要です。 </p> <p>PHP を使用してデータを含むクエリ文字列を作成しています。 </p> <p>現在の PHP コードは次のとおりです: </p> <pre class="brush:php;toolbar:false;">$array = [ ['id' => 1, 'name' => 'one'], ['id' => 2, 'name' => 'two'], ['id' => 3, 'name' => 'three'] ]; $subQuery = "SELECT {$array[0]['id']} AS Col1, '{$array[0]['name']}' AS Col2'; for ($i=1; $i
P粉066224086P粉066224086450日前545

全員に返信(1)返信します

  • P粉781235689

    P粉7812356892023-09-04 00:48:43

    MySQL 8 を使用する場合、json_table 式を次のように使用できます:

    リーリー

    PHP オンライン エディター

    MySQL 8.0 では、上記のクエリの結果は次のようになります:

    リーリー

    返事
    0
  • キャンセル返事